abase to diminish (something of value) or to place (especially oneself) in a lower position than another or others; lower; demean.
appreciation a feeling of thanks.
artistic showing skill and imagination in creating.
caption the words that describe a picture or graph in a magazine, book, or newspaper.
clarity the state or condition of being clear or being understood.
dubious having or showing doubt; skeptical.
inattention lack of attentiveness; neglect.
leery suspicious or mistrustful; wary (usually followed by "of").
loiter to stand around idly.
negligence disregard of, omission of, or failure to do something necessary, especially when it is habitual.
oppose to think, act, or be against; resist.
prominent easy to see or notice because of some difference.
slay to kill deliberately and violently.
tolerance willingness to accept people whose race, religion, opinions, or habits are different from one's own.
urban of or having to do with a city or town.
